Fear about home prices is driven more by headlines than data. After 43+ years watching the Tampa Bay market through every cycle, our team can tell you the actual price story is calmer than the media makes it sound: prices appreciated through most of the past year, with normal seasonal dips that look scarier in isolation than they actually are.

Why “negative news sells” matters

Real estate is a headline machine. Sensational price-crash predictions get clicks. But Case-Shiller’s monthly data shows home prices rose in the majority of months over the past 12–18 months, with brief pauses (often seasonal) that hardly register against the longer trend.

What the data actually shows

  • Home prices rose in most months over the past 18 months
  • Seasonal slowdowns in late fall/early winter are normal
  • Spring activity reignites the trend
  • Tampa Bay specifically continues to outperform many national averages

Why a major drop is unlikely

  • Supply remains below pre-pandemic norms
  • Demand is supported by net migration to Florida
  • Homeowner equity is at record highs — few forced sales
  • Lending standards are tight (the opposite of 2008)

What this means for you

If you are a buyer, waiting for a major price drop has been an expensive strategy. If you are a seller, current prices remain solid — but pricing accurately to current comps matters.
